Tea towel skirt



Summer is just starting to hit Melbourne and I started thinking about the holiday we took in 2003 to the Greek Islands. I found a tourist tea towel of Sicily at an op-shop and that combined with some left-over red cotton was enough to inspire this skirt.

This was also the first piece that I used to try out my BRAND NEW over locker. Unfortunately it's very easy to get carried away with these things and so this nice little 'Island of the Sun' patch is actually covering a boo boo i.e. frustratingly large hole.


I'm not really a hugely curvy person, but I had made the skirt so straight, that it was difficult to walk in. I generally find walking to be a necessary mode of transport, so I fixed the problem by putting a slit up the back and decorating it with pieces cut off the edge of the tea towel.

Tea towels have huge potential as an upcycling material. They generally have bright, colourful graphics and opp-shops are generally only too pleased to find somebody who actually wants them!
